Minsk, April 3 /Sinyaya/ — Belarus’s gold and currency reserves as of April 1, 2026, amounted to 15.2 billion US dollars. The corresponding information was published by the press service of the National Bank of Belarus on Friday.
The country’s international reserve assets decreased by $1.1 billion in March due to the decline in gold prices in the international financial market.
The largest share in the structure of Belarus’ international reserve assets is occupied by assets in foreign currency and monetary gold. According to the National Bank’s data, the volume of foreign currency in reserves as of April 1, 2026 exceeded 5.85 billion dollars, having decreased by 58.5 million dollars in March. The volume of monetary gold amounted to more than 7.98 billion dollars, having decreased by more than 1.05 billion dollars.
According to the target indicators of monetary-credit policy, the volume of Belarus’s international reserve assets at the end of 2026 should be at least 9.2 billion dollars. –0–
